Japan - Export of Extracts of Glands for Therapeutic Use
Since 2014, Japan Export of Extracts of Glands for Therapeutic Use was up 12.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 4 comparing other countries in Export of Extracts of Glands for Therapeutic Use with $25,742,610. Japan is overtaken by Denmark, which was ranked number 3 with $28,602,028 and is followed by Australia with $18,349,591.75. United Kingdom topped the ranking with $131,260,542.7 in 2019, a growth of 178.2% versus 2018. Oman recorded the best 5 years average growth at +213.6% per year, while Kazakhstan witnessed the worst performance at -68.4% per year.
